Renowned cellist Alisa Weilerstein and acclaimed pianist Inon Barnatan present an evening of chamber music that showcases the intimate artistry these two world-class musicians bring to the concert stage. Weilerstein, a MacArthur Fellowship recipient, is celebrated for her passionate interpretations and technical mastery, while Barnatan is recognized as one of the most compelling pianists of his generation, known for his poetic sensitivity and intellectual depth. Together, they form a duo that has captivated audiences worldwide with their musical chemistry and interpretive insight.

About Davies Symphony Hall

Davies Symphony Hall stands as San Francisco's premier destination for orchestral music, serving as the home of the renowned San Francisco Symphony. This elegant concert hall hosts an impressive range of performances beyond classical music, welcoming jazz ensembles, alternative acts, film screenings with live orchestral accompaniment, and contemporary artists who push the boundaries of traditional concert presentation.

The hall is celebrated for its exceptional acoustics, carefully designed to showcase the full dynamic range of orchestral works while maintaining intimate clarity for solo performances. The warm, enveloping sound creates an immersive experience whether you're experiencing a thunderous Beethoven symphony or a delicate chamber piece. The venue's thoughtful design ensures excellent sightlines throughout, allowing audiences to connect visually with performers and feel part of the musical conversation unfolding on stage.

Nestled in San Francisco's Civic Center, Davies Symphony Hall anchors the city's cultural district alongside the Opera House and other major arts institutions.
